If you are painting a matte paint , such as milk paint , chalk paint or mud paint , then wax is a great option. It give the shine you ‘d like, and absorbs well into these paints to give it a very durable finish.
Satin : A paint with a satin finish reflects a minimal amount of light (eggshell is a closely related finish). If you like the look of matte paint , but need a paint for furniture that is more durable, then satin paint may be the best choice for you. If you opt for a washable formula, you’ll find it easier to keep clean.

Most times you paint furniture with latex paint , you need to protect the finish with a sealer or topcoat . If you are painting a piece of furniture that will not be heavily used, you may be able to skip the sealer. If you do , be sure to be extra gentle with your furniture for the first month of use.
Furniture doesn’t need to be sanded or primed. Chalk paint is easy to sand smooth once dry which makes eliminating any brush strokes easy so you can create a super smooth finish. Chalk paint is very durable when cured and when you add a wax or water-based polyurethane protective finish.
Wax as a top coat, does not apply when you have used Latex paint because as you may know- Latex has a rubbery surface and the wax cannot penetrate it. Latex literally floats on the surface – which is why you always use a primer first to give the Latex paint something to “bite” to. But back on focus regarding wax .

Paste wax has been used for centuries to seal, protect and add shine to wood furniture . Paste wax dries to a hard, but very thin, protective finish which makes it the best choice for maintaining fully finished furniture . Paste wax contains no chemicals that can dry out wood furniture .
Johnson Paste Wax is safe for painted furniture . It is a fairly clear wax so if you are waxing over white paint it will not leave an orange-ish tint as some wax will.

Why? Because both chalk and milk painted furniture is porous in nature – wax easily absorbs into the surface. When the wax hardens, it seals the painted surface with a lovely natural looking soft sheen. The sheen can then be controlled by additional buffing.
Applying one or two coats of polyurethane to a painted surface is a good way to protect the paint . Oil-based polyurethane levels out to a smoother finish, although it takes several hours longer to dry. You can apply polyurethane over any type of paint , as long as it’s clean and has been properly prepared.
